πŸ₯˜ 2.  The food scene is unreal

You can eat your way through this city and never be disappointed.  My picks?

  • Poogan’s Porch for southern comfort brunch

  • Callie’s Hot Little Biscuit for grab-and-go deliciousness

  • Husk for something a little fancier—but still so comforting


πŸ›Ά 3.  So many ways to unwind

Whether you want to take a carriage ride, tour the waterfront, visit plantations and gardens, or just relax on nearby Folly Beach—Charleston gives you the freedom to wander or rest.
